New C35 chassis not ready for struggling Nasr – Sauber

New C35 chassis not ready for struggling Nasr – Sauber Felipe Nasr will not be able to end his early 2016 troubles by switching to a new Sauber chassis this weekend in Russia. After complaining about the handling of his chassis in all three race weekends so far and suspecting a flaw, it had been reported Nasr would get an all-new version of the C35 for Russia. 'I am 100 per cent sure the car is not right,' Nasr was quoted by Brazil's UOL after China. 'I'm struggling all the time but he (teammate Marcus Ericsson)'s happy with the car from the start.
